Douglas, of Scottish origin, derives from the Gaelic 'Dubhghlas', meaning 'dark stranger' or 'from the dark-blue stream'. Historically, it is associated with the powerful Douglas clan, symbolizing leadership and nobility. The name remains popular in English-speaking countries for its strong, timeless appeal.
